- Naked short selling is a controversial practice in the cryptocurrency industry. To prevent it, regulators have implemented various measures. For example, some countries require cryptocurrency exchanges to enforce strict Know Your Customer (KYC) procedures, which help ensure that traders have sufficient funds to cover their positions. Additionally, exchanges may impose limits on margin trading to prevent excessive leverage and potential naked short selling. These measures aim to promote transparency and protect investors from market manipulation.

- Regulations and measures to prevent naked short selling in the cryptocurrency industry vary across jurisdictions. Some countries have banned or restricted short selling altogether, while others have implemented strict reporting requirements for short positions. In addition, regulatory bodies may conduct regular audits of cryptocurrency exchanges to ensure compliance with anti-manipulation rules. It's important for traders to understand the specific regulations in their jurisdiction and comply with them to avoid legal consequences.
